[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Please share if you or they regret their decision. How did it work out as far as college admissions. Did it end up being a factor?[/quote] Unless you're a recruited athlete, there is no chance of getting into a top 20 school without at least Calculus AB, never mind pre-cal or less. Zero chance. The first thing colleges look at is course rigor. Dropping the ball in math is a quick way to the reject pile. There might be some exceptions for very high SAT or ACT math scores and maybe some artsy schools like Juilliard, but generally, no chance. It's not 1989 anymore. Smart kids are expected to do calculus these days.[/quote]
